What is Ocean?
Built on IRC. Beyond IRC.
Ocean is the modern web client for the eshmaki.me IRC network. It brings the communication features you expect from modern platforms — voice, reactions, rich media, threads — while staying faithful to the open IRC protocol underneath.
Everything runs on Ophion, a custom IRC server built from the ground up to support modern clients without abandoning IRC compatibility. Any standard IRC client can still connect. Ocean is just the best way to experience the network.
The Technology
Four layers, one network.
IRC Servereshmaki.me:6697
Ophion
A custom IRC server built for performance and modern protocol extensions. Supports IRCv3, IRCX, CHATHISTORY, and full SASL auth including session tokens.
View source ↗Media ProtocolNative transport · No relay
LADON
Proprietary voice and video protocol built over IRC messaging. Native transport — no relay servers, no third-party infrastructure. Spatial audio and video delivered through the Ophion network.
EncryptionP-256 ECDH · AES-256-GCM
VEIL
P-256 ECDH key exchange with AES-256-GCM encryption for every LADON session. Group session keys derived with forward secrecy — no plaintext voice leaves your device.
Web Clientopen source
Ocean
Next.js static export with Zustand state management. Dark luxury design system, bento layouts, and a full-featured IRC client under the hood.
Principles
Why we built this.
01
Open protocol
IRC is 35+ years old for good reason. Federated, simple, and proven. We extend it — we don't replace it.
02
No third parties
Voice goes through Ophion, not Google, not Amazon. Your conversations don't pass through infrastructure you don't control.
03
Privacy by design
Session tokens replace stored passwords. VEIL encrypts voice before it leaves your device. No analytics, no tracking.
04
Actually good software
Not "good for IRC". Just good. Spatial audio, live reactions, collaborative whiteboard, rich embeds — done right.
